“The Earth of Random Numbers” - a collection of short stories by Tatyana Zamirovskaya, writer and journalist, the author loudly sounded the novel “Death.net.”
All the heroes of the book are hostage by the author. The reality of each world is strictly defined and outlined, but this does not mean that you cannot get out, violate, overcome the boundaries. All that is needed is to look at yourself-Mir-enlarged differently, from a different angle. Problems with memory can turn out to be an ordinary afterlife bureaucracy, voices in the head-exiled to the minds of the souls of tyrants and scientists of the 20th century, and the story of a ghost girl-a neurological detective in the spirit of Oliver Sax. The optics of Zamirovskaya is incredible and generous, it is she who allows the heroes to acquire where, it would seem, there is nothing.
